Introduction:
Punjab Medical College, Faisalabad is catering for Healthcare
and training services for a wide area of Pakistan. Much of the
draining area is underserved in many respects due to poor
infrastructure and low literacy rate. There is heightened demand
of dedication and community oriented education and training.
University of Health Sciences is trying to transform the whole
educational system in Punjab to bring it at par with the rest of
the world. Departments of Medical Education are now becoming
essential requirement for all the Medical Schools and so is
being emphasized by the University. In an attempt to start these
activites in the Medical Colleges affiliated with the UHS, a
special program for training of Master trainers was started and
a series of workshops were conducted at UHS. An instruction was
passed on to the colleges for establishment of formal Medical
Education Departments. Professor Dr. Asghar Ali Randawa,
Prinicipal Punjab Medical College took the initiative and a
committee was formed to start the Department. This committee was
headed by Professor Dr. Riaz Hussain Dab, Head of Surgical
Department and comprised two members, Dr. Khuram Suhail Raja and
Dr. Imtiaz Ahmad Dogar being master trainers. The committee
conducted workshops and started looking for a qualified Medical
Educationist to provide exclusive services for the Department as
Director. Dr. Musarrat ul Hasnain was approached, who, had
successfully completed DCPS-HPE, Advance Diploma in HPE (AKU)
and working on his MHPE from Aga Khan University. Prof. Randhawa
approached Health Department Punjab and got Dr. Musarrat
transferred to Punjab Medical College. The Department started
with these members and necessary steps are being taken to
conform it to the expectations of the stakeholders and target
learners. The beginning work has been encouraging and it was
decided to document the activities in a report after every year.
The first report is being released after initial four months to
furnish a landmark for the activities of the department.
Foundation Works:
-
We have defined Vision, Mission, Goals and Objectives
of the department of Medical Education.
-
A Departmental Faculty has been established, which,
includes interested faculty members from other departments.
They will have joint appointments. There are other resource
persons working in Govt. and Private sectors, who have joined
a honorary faculty to contribute in teaching programs of DME.
-
We are in the process of installing a Curriculum Committee
working for the improvement of the curriculum.
-
Basic resource requirements are
being completed. The Principal is very supportive in this
context.
-
Proposals, PC1 and SNEs are being
prepared for Formal sanction of Medical Education
Departments along with creating of posts by the Health
Department Punjab.
-
Need assessment to identify the
gaps in knowledge and skills of faculty has been carried by
informal discussions with the faculty, administration and
students.

The workshop was
inaugurated by Prof. Asghar Ali Randhawa, Principal, Punjab
Medical College. In his address he stressed the need for more
research projects in the institution and appreciated the
interest of faculty members as evidenced by their attendance. He
promised to extend full support to the DME and other departments
for educational actitivities.
Prof. Riaz Hussain
Dab, Head of Surgical Department observed the first day session
and gave his valuable suggestions at the conclusion of first
day. He advised that the workshop should have more components of
exercises and actual practice of different steps of research be
included.. Prof. Rukhsana Majid explained that due to the short
available time it was not possible to enhance the duration of
time for exercising the steps, however this will be taken care
of in longer workshop next time. The workshop ended at 2:00 pm
on 27th July,08. Certificates were distributed by
Prof. Rukhsana Majid.
After feedback of the
participants it was decided that another workshop will be
arranged in the current year with same group. Therefore a second
workshop with same participants will be held before end of this
year. This will be of five days duration. Reading material will
be given in advance with a request that the participants will
come up with there projects and these projects will be discussed
in the workshop. For the remaining interested faculty members
another series of the same workshop will be organized.
DME is also planning
short courses of Basic Concepts in research methodology and
Biostatistics.

Workshop on Communication Skills:
A workshop on communication skills was conducted in CPC Room
from 25th to 26th August, 2008. Dr. Aziz
ur Rab (A facilitator for CPSP workshops) facilitated this
program. Forty participants attended the workshops. They include
good mix of senior, middle and junior level doctors. Nominations
exceeded 80 so another workshops of remaining persons will be
conducted in few months time.
Upcoming Workshops:
The Department has started working on Curriculum Development.
Three workshops have been arranged on Integration, PBL
facilitator training and MCQ development from 7th to
16th October, 2008. Professor Dr. Alam Sher Malik,
Prof. of Paediatrics/Assistant Dean (Education) University Mara
Technology, Malaysia has very kindly consented to be the main
facilitator.
Capacity Building Courses:
In the light of need assessment, our Department has planned two
courses:
-
Computer
Skills Course.
This will bridge the gap of computer skills. A questionnaire
has been sent to the faculty members for assessing the current
computer skill and this will determine the final content of
the course. Meanwhile, a pilot course has been started having
two one hours sessions in a week. Nine senior faculty members
are participating in this program and they have termed it very
useful. Next course will be started after having feedback from
the present participants.
-
Research
Methodology and Biostatics Course.
The Department is making an effort to arrange for resource
persons for starting this course. Some experts have been
contacted and the terms are being discussed. This will take
start in few months time.
Collaboration:
It has been decided to initiate and establish strong
collaboration with the University of Health Sciences and
Pakistan Medical and Dental Council. Collaboration will be
sought at International level as well. Prof. Dr. Riaz Hussain,
Head of Surgical Department and Dr. Musarrat ul Hasnain,
Director, DME are going to attend International Congress on
“Implementation of WFME standards in curricula of Undergraduate
Medical Education” at Kish Island Iran in Nov,2008.
